			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>We&#8217;ve had frosty mornings in London lately and both girls are now in itch free wool underwear underneath the School uniform, keeping them warm and dry throughout the day. We&#8217;ve mentioned <a href="http://lillileopold.com/" target="_blank">Lilli &#038; Leopold</a> before, with regards to <a href="http://littlescandinavian.com/2011/01/11/warm-and-dry-with-wool-underwear/" target="_blank">staying warm and dry with wool underwear</a>. The girls wears the essential off white tank top, the long sleeved top and leggings; Little A has a beautiful dusty pink set in size 7y and Little B has a blue set in size 10y, slightly more grown up. Lilli &#038; Leopold wool underwear are true to size and do not shrink much. The wool garments are produced under organic conditions and is so soft and luxurious that it can be worn next to the skin of even the most delicate babies and child as it&#8217;s naturally non allergenic and itch free, while at the same time giving a durable fabric which will endure numerous washes, by hand or on a wool program 30C using detergent designed for wool.<br />
We think wool underwear is essential in any wardrobe especially when the temperature drops down to only a few plus degrees.<br />

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Norwegian company <a href="http://www.janus.no/" target="_blank">Janus</a> has produced wool garments since 1895 and are mostly known for their <a href="http://littlescandinavian.com/2010/11/02/janus-wool-underwear/">itch free wool underwear</a>. Here&#8217;s little A, <a href="http://littlescandinavian.com/2010/04/07/easter/">Our very own Easter Bunny</a>, wearing her pink princess wool top with laces.  Due to demand and increased popularity they&#8217;ve now launched children&#8217;s wear as well. As the temperature drops in the UK it was a warming news that Janus wool clothing for children is available in the UK. Here are a few warming news; Little Scandinavian&#8217;s favourite picks for the autumn winter season. </p>
<p><img src="http://static.littlescandinavian.com/2011/09/janus_tipsy_wool_babygown_purple_lge.jpg" alt="" title="janus_tipsy_wool_babygown_purple_lge" width="320" height="320"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-11996" /><img src="http://static.littlescandinavian.com/2011/09/janus_tipsy_baby_wool_body_brown_lge.jpg" alt="" title="janus_tipsy_baby_wool_body_brown_lge" width="320" height="320"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-11995" /><br clear=left>The non-itchy temperature regulating Tipsy Baby Wool Dress is made from a combination of wool and silk, making it soft and comfortable. This is a highly practical garment, being a combination of a long sleeved baby body and a gorgeous girls dress at the same time -with buttons at the crotch for easy changing. The design takes inspiration from older Janus design traditions – the hen print. Wear it with wool tights for a warm, snug and beautiful outfit. 			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Norwegian company Lilleba uses bamboo and soy to produce their clothes. Bamboo and soy clothing is made from a natural product that&#8217;s breathable, has outstanding anti-bacterial and moisture wicking qualities, and is luxuriously soft making it suitable for everybody from newborn babies to adults.<br />
This utterly luxurious fabrics combined with a design clearly inspired by Scandinavian heritage and traditions makes Lilleba a first choice for underwear and nightwear.<br />
<br /> <br />
Lilleba has won several design prices in Norway and Scandinavia, not only for the beautiful design, cut and finish but also for caring for the children and the environment. <a href="http://www.lilleba.no"target="_blank">www.lilleba.no</a><br />

<p>Clothes worn against the skin should be soft, with a minimal amount of seams and free from itching tags. The Norwegian design team Silje Sivertsen and Nina Eikerol combine Nordic traditions and a clear cut look with the most modern qualities. They also consider a safe production of clothes under conditions favourable to people as well as the environment.<br />
This underwear is especially recommended for children with sensitive skin or eczema. As for soy, besides being soft as cashmere, it is a vegetable protein fiber with qualities similar to those of wool. It is also UV protective 50+. The fabrics do not contain formaldehyde, which can cause both allergy and cancer.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Playing dressing up in mummy’s high heels, tottering around the bedroom is one thing. Or even wearing Cinderella shoes while playing the princess at home.</p>
<p>But actually going out in public in your own pair of heels when you’re barely three years old? And not only once or twice for that special occasion, but more on a everyday basis? And then your mother thinks you should, because you love them, and that they can&#8217;t be too damaging, since they where bought in a dance shop?</p>
<p>First I was thinking that this was some mad celebrity stunt, that wouldn&#8217;t affect us &#8220;ordinary people&#8221;.  It was therefor with shock and horror that I recently discovered lots of sparkly high heeled tiny shoes in one of the high street accessorise shops.<br />
And then you have the  extremely funny, completely soft, shoes for babies 0-6 months, designed to look like high heels. What&#8217;s the point? What&#8217;s wrong with being a baby whilst you still can? An I do certainly not find these shoes hilarious! Only sad.<br clear=left></p>
<p><a href="http://static.littlescandinavian.com/2010/01/Petit-by-Sofie-Schnoor-underwear-1.jpg"><img src="http://static.littlescandinavian.com/2010/01/Petit-by-Sofie-Schnoor-underwear-1-136x300.jpg" alt="" title="Petit by Sofie Schnoor underwear" width="136" height="300" class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-1400" /></a>Then a supermarket giant launched padded bras for girls as young as seven. The &#8220;bust-booster&#8221; bra was sold alongside vests in the supermarket&#8217;s seven to eight-year-old range.<br />
Another supermarket was also marketing black lacy underwear to nine-year-old girls.</p>
<p>The Archbishop of Canterbury, Dr Rowan Williams, said children were being psychologically damaged by inappropriate &#8220;sexy&#8221; clothing and toys.<br />
Christopher Cloke, head of child protection awareness at the NSPCC, said:</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;This is part of a worrying trend of inappropriate clothing being marketed at young children.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
<p>I find myself strongly agreeing with these statements. It&#8217;s a worrying trend.<br /> <br />
Having two young girls myself I can&#8217;t help thinking what if Amélie should prance around in high heels and Beatrice wear a padded pink lace bra?! What&#8217;s wrong with letting children be the innocent children that they in fact are? I think it&#8217;s important for parents not being too naive on this topic, but on the contrary make a clear statement.
